The annual Clintonville Jamboree is back June 21, 5-8pm featuring live music, food, art pop-ups, kids activities and more. 

Taking place along N. High St. in Clintonville, the Jamboree will feature businesses from the surrounding area who will each offer their own definition of a good-time. Shops will stay open late to welcome the festivities – with several providing unique deals.

Over 15 community partners will participate in the event, including Virtue Salon with free face paint and coloring pages for kids, The Brass Hand with free hand-painted ceramic animals, Zen Yoga with a free yoga class and World Peaces with food, music and vendors for anyone to enjoy.

During the jamboree, The Brass Hand will also be launching their Discover Clintonville Passport in partnership with over 25 small businesses in the Clintonville area. 

Running until October 11, individuals can take their passports to any of the participating stores to receive a stamp. Collecting 15 stamps earns the prize of a specially designed ‘Discover Clintonville’ sticker, while 25 stamps earns a tote-bag bearing the same phrase alongside the sticker.

This Saturday will mark the second of four jamboree dates – the remaining two taking place on August 30 and October 11. 

With Clintonville being such a historic area within the surrounding Columbus area, both events welcome anyone from any-age group to explore the local shops and businesses that build the community into what it is today.
